SP5 2QE is a mixed residential, non-residential and agricultural postcode in Morgan's Vale, Wiltshire. It was first introduced in January 1980.
The most common council tax bands are D, H and F.
Residential buildings are primarily detached. Domestic properties are mostly houses and bungalows.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£148,127 to £1,533,102 with an average of £692,000.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1950 and 1966, before 1900 and between 1983 and 1990.
None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are mostly owner occupied, with some privately rented
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C, G and E.
Commercial rateable values range from £4,850 to £175,000 with an average of £43,660. The most common recorded business types are Quarry and Garage. Farms and agricultural buildings do not pay business rates and are not included in these figures.
In the 2011 census, there were 36 people resident in SP5 2QE, of which 19 were male and 17 were female.
SP5 2QE is in the Salisbury trav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Wiltshire Primary Care Trust.
SP5 2QE is approximately 94m (308ft) above sea level.
